But the real irritation lies in the bonus structure. A “free” 20‑spin offer on Fairy Forest appears to be generous, yet the wagering requirement of 40× the bonus amount forces the player to wager £800 to clear a £20 win – a ratio comparable to the 1:40 conditions on Gonzo’s Quest’s free spins.
